Job Overview
The Principal Statistical Analyst - Real World Data plays a key role in leading and supporting statistical programming activities related to the analysis of real-world data. This involves working closely with biostatisticians, epidemiologists, clinical scientists, medical affairs, health economics, and outcome scientists to ensure high-quality and compliant deliverables in a timely manner that support real-world evidence generation and regulatory submissions.

Main Responsibilities:
  • Develop, validate, and maintain statistical programs for the analysis of real-world data, ensuring compliance with internal SOPs.
  • Perform RWD related tasks, including data cleaning, data transformation, and analysis data creation from multiple sources, while ensuring data quality and integrity.
  • Implement statistical analysis plans (SAP) and generate tables, listings, and figures (TLFs) to support publication and regulatory submissions.
  • Develop analytical methods leveraging RWD to answer life science key business questions such as line of therapy, compliance/persistence, patient journey, treatment pattern, and comparative effectiveness.
  • Consolidate data from various real-world sources (e.g., electronic health records, claims data, registries) to prepare analysis-ready datasets.
  • Create and maintain documentation for programming to ensure reproducibility and transparency.
  • Assist in the preparation of statistical reports, presentations, and publications.
  • Conduct quality control checks on datasets and statistical outputs to ensure accuracy.
